CIM-PA Q4 2025 Earnings Call Summary

1. Key Financial Results and Metrics

  • GAAP Net Income: $7 million ($0.08 per share) for Q4; $144 million ($1.72 per share) for the full year.
  • GAAP Book Value: $19.70 per share at the end of Q4.
  • Economic Return: Negative 0.9% for Q4; positive 7.4% for the full year.
  • Earnings Available for Distribution (EAD): $45 million ($0.53 per share) for Q4; $141 million ($1.68 per share) for the full year.
  • Dividend Increase: Raised by 22% to $0.45 per share for Q1 2026, with expectations to maintain this level throughout the year.
  • Leverage Ratios: Total leverage at 5.1 to 1; Rico's leverage at 2.4 to 1.

2. Strategic Updates and Business Highlights

  • Portfolio Diversification: Transitioned to 61% loans, 16% agency securities, and 10% non-agency securities, with 11% in lending activities and 1% in mortgage servicing rights (MSRs).
  • Acquisition of Home Express Mortgage: Completed for $244 million, enhancing capabilities and expanding reach in non-QM loans.
  • Increased Assets Under Management (AUM): Grew from $22 billion to $26 billion, with the addition of advisory services.
  • Operational Integration: Successfully integrated loan data into Palisade's systems, improving portfolio performance.
  • Economic Net Interest Income: $65 million for Q4, with a yield on average interest-earning assets at 5.9%.

3. Forward Guidance and Outlook

  • 2026 Focus: Continue to diversify the portfolio, expand liquidity, and grow fee-based income through organic growth and acquisitions.
  • Market Expectations: Anticipate strong demand for non-QM loans, projecting significant growth in origination volume.
  • Capital Deployment: Plans to redeploy capital into agency MBS, MSRs, and select credit investments, while evaluating potential platform acquisitions.

4. Challenges and Points of Concern

  • Book Value Decline: Reported a 2.7% decline in book value due to increased fair value of securitized debt, which outpaced gains from loan values.
  • Economic Returns: Economic return on GAAP book value was negative for Q4, raising concerns about short-term performance.
  • Increased Expenses: Compensation and administrative expenses rose by $22 million year-over-year, primarily due to acquisitions.

5. Notable Q&A Insights

  • Home Express Performance: Anticipated a strong first quarter in 2026, with good gain on sale premiums and a seasonal reduction in volume post-holidays.
  • Dividend Strategy: Management emphasized balancing dividend payouts with capital retention for growth, indicating a cautious approach to future dividend guidance.
  • Market Dynamics: Discussed the potential for GSEs to sell more loans to create room for MBS purchases, which could impact market liquidity.
  • Non-QM Market Outlook: Projected significant growth in the non-QM sector, with estimates of $110 billion to $130 billion in origination volume for 2026.
